Output 07abe2e32fc1196daa9178834e3b00431c6aa9d1b2b16d10b12e0f93718d5ed7:4

value
2677629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 60ad672b36b02f659dd38bd891ed0c45a8196fc8 OP_EQUAL
address
3AWCXDDEzjBXLUG7tBWhE4b2RyE8zSQU6a
transaction
07abe2e32fc1196daa9178834e3b00431c6aa9d1b2b16d10b12e0f93718d5ed7
spent
true